Technical specifications for QO340GFI

ManufacturerSchneider Electric
Product TypeMiniature Circuit-Breaker
Product LineSquare D
Part NumberQO340GFI
UPC785901979043
Weight0.50 lbs (0.23 kg)
Current Rating40 A
Voltage Rating208Y/120 V AC
Mounting TypePlug-in
Number of Poles3P
Electrical ConnectionBox Lugs
Interrupt Rating10 kA
Tightening Torque5 N.m
Ambient Rating40 °C
Wire SizeAWG 12
Number of Panel Spaces3
Circuit Breaker TypeGround Fault Protecting Class A 6 mA
CertificationsUL Listed, CSA

The Schneider Electric QO340GFI is a specialized miniature circuit-breaker designed to offer excellent protection for electrical circuits. Capable of handling a current of 40 A, it operates efficiently within a voltage range of 208Y/120 V AC, making it suitable for a wide range of applications. This device is designed as a plug-in type for straightforward installation and features three poles, enabling its operation in multi-phase systems.

Electrical connections are made via box lugs, ensuring a secure and reliable attachment. Built to withstand significant overcurrent situations, the breaker boasts an interrupt rating of 10 kA. Additionally, it requires a tightening torque of 5 N.m during installation, which is critical for maintaining performance integrity.

The circuit breaker is classified as a ground fault protection device, specifically designed to operate at a sensitivity level of 6 mA. It can perform optimally in environments with an ambient temperature of up to 40 °C.

Weighing in at 0.640 kg, this circuit-breaker has a wire size compatibility of AWG 12 and occupies three panel spaces. Designed for safety and efficiency, the QO340GFI meets industry standards with UL and CSA certifications. Its compact dimensions—105 mm in height, 57 mm in width, and 74 mm in depth — make it an excellent choice for tight spaces.
